Championing SDG 7: Affordable and clean energy
- With energy consumption skyrocketing in Pakistan, International Industries is at the forefront of utilizing renewable energy and intelligent energy systems that reduce the use of fossil fuels, ensuring the production of sustainable steel in Pakistan.
- International Industries Limited installed solar power systems in its Karachi and Sheikhupura plants, comprising a 4 MW system. This decreases the carbon footprint and operational cost of the company by a significant amount.
- Further to this, International Industries solarized two TCF school campuses as well, so that schools in underprivileged areas can gain uninterrupted access to education, even during load shedding.
These actions directly contribute to the UN Sustainable Development Goals in Pakistan, through enabling affordable, clean, and sustainable energy for everyone.
Industry that Responsibly Innovates: SDG 9 & SDG 12
The company's investment in process enhancement and clean technology places it at the forefront of using sustainable steel in Pakistan's industrialization.
- International Industries produces long-duration, recyclable, sustainable steel and polymer pipes in Pakistan, which obviates the necessity of frequent replacement and reduces overall material waste.
- Its well-situated Sheikhupura facility optimizes logistics while reducing distribution fuel consumption, saving emissions through improved delivery performance.
- It has ISO certifications for Environmental Management System (EMS) (ISO 14001), occupational health and safety (OH&S) management system (ISO 45001), and Quality Management System (QMS) (ISO 9001), thereby testifying to its green manufacturing processes.
All these measures align with SDG 9 (Industry, Innovation, Technology and Infrastructure ) and SDG 12 (Responsible Consumption and Production), contributing to the UN Sustainable Development Goals in Pakistan.

Investing in People: SDG 4 & SDG 8
Sustainability is not only green, it's social as well. International Industries positively contributes to education and economic empowerment across Pakistan, supporting the UN Sustainable Development Goals in Pakistan.
- Sponsorships of 2 The Citizens Foundation (TCF) campuses and other donations to schools, International Industries are filling the gaps towards improved livelihoods.
- SINA Foundation, Indus Hospital, and other NGOs' partnerships ensure better access to healthcare in society.
- International Industries provides a safe working environment, equal opportunities for labor, and gender representation among laborers. Its CSR policy values workers' dignity, professional development, and well-being.
International Industries contributes to SDG 4 (Quality Education) SDG 5 (Gender equality) and SDG 8 (Decent Work and Economic Growth) through these initiatives.
